Overview

Check any page against your own required and forbidden terms. Local, private and no sign-up.

PageChecklist helps content managers, web teams, and QA reviewers check the page they are about to publish or approve. Save a checklist — required phrases, forbidden phrases, and a small set of automatic checks — then select it and click Scan page. PageChecklist answers with READY TO PUBLISH, or the number of issues found, and lists every check it ran: - Required phrases that are present, and required phrases that are missing - Forbidden phrases that were found - The number of matches for each phrase - Uppercase TODO or FIXME left in the page text - Lorem ipsum placeholder text - Links written to localhost, 127.0.0.1 or a .local host - Links whose host has a staging, stage, dev, test, uat, preview, qa or sandbox label Each automatic check can be switched on or off per checklist, every result shows the evidence it found, and clicking an issue scrolls to it on the page. Matches are highlighted in place, and Clear highlights restores the page exactly. READY TO PUBLISH means every check in the checklist you selected passed. It is not a claim that the page has been verified against anything else. Keep as many checklists as you need — one per site, per page type or per review — and switch between them in the popup. Matching is case-insensitive, supports common dash variations, and works across ordinary inline page elements. Privacy is built in: - Page content is processed only in the active tab after you click Scan page - Your checklists are stored locally in Chrome - No account or sign-up - No analytics or tracking - No network requests - No page content, URLs, or scan history are saved Known limitations: iframes and closed Shadow DOM roots are not scanned, links are checked by the address written in the page rather than by visiting them, and dynamically added text requires a new manual scan.
